The Role
You’ll be responsible for leading and delivering statutory audits for a varied portfolio of clients, including owner-managed businesses, SMEs and limited companies across different sectors.
Your responsibilities will include:
- Planning and delivering statutory audit assignments
- Performing risk assessments and identifying key audit issues
- Reviewing junior team members' work and providing support and guidance
- Preparing statutory accounts for limited companies
- Ensuring compliance with relevant accounting and regulatory requirements
- Completing audit assignments within agreed deadlines
- Liaising with clients, managers and partners to resolve technical matters
- Supporting the development and coaching of junior members of the team
- Maintaining consistently high audit and professional standards
About You
We’re looking for an experienced audit professional who can demonstrate:
- At least 3 years' experience within a UK audit practice environment
- Experience leading and delivering statutory audits across a diverse client portfolio
- Strong experience with owner-managed businesses, SMEs and limited companies
- Experience preparing statutory accounts
- Strong technical knowledge of FRS 102, FRS 102 Section 1A and UK GAAP
- A good working knowledge of relevant auditing standards, including UK ISAs
- Experience planning audits, carrying out risk assessments and identifying key audit issues
- The ability to supervise, coach and review junior team members
- Strong client communication and relationship-building skills
- A proactive, resilient and team-focused approach
- Currently studying towards, or already qualified in, ACA/ACCA
